    What is Ipsei Massage and Sports Therapy?

    So, what exactly is Ipsei Massage and Sports Therapy? Think of it as a specialized form of massage therapy that's tailored to the unique needs of athletes and active individuals. It's not your average spa day rubdown, guys. Instead, it's a strategic approach that combines various massage techniques, stretching, and sometimes even other modalities like cupping or scraping, to address specific issues related to athletic performance and physical activity. Ipsei massage focuses on the muscles, tendons, ligaments, and fascia – the connective tissue that surrounds and supports your muscles. The primary goal is to enhance athletic performance, speed up recovery, and help prevent injuries. Sport therapy goes beyond massage. It might include postural assessment, gait analysis, and corrective exercises to address underlying imbalances that can contribute to pain or decreased performance. Ipsei massage is focused on the body and sport therapy is focused on the sports activities itself.

    The therapists who practice this type of therapy are typically highly trained and possess a deep understanding of human anatomy and kinesiology. They know how muscles work, how injuries occur, and how to effectively treat them. Their expertise allows them to identify and address issues like muscle imbalances, trigger points (those pesky knots!), and restricted range of motion. Ipsei massage and sports therapy is not just for professional athletes. It's beneficial for anyone who's physically active, from weekend warriors to fitness enthusiasts to people who simply enjoy staying active and healthy. The types of therapies may include but are not limited to, deep tissue massage, myofascial release, trigger point therapy, and sports massage.

    Techniques Used in Ipsei Massage and Sports Therapy

    Ipsei Massage and Sports Therapy encompasses a variety of techniques, each designed to address specific issues and meet the unique needs of the individual. Here are some of the most common:

    • Deep Tissue Massage: This technique uses firm pressure to reach the deeper layers of muscle and fascia. It's often used to release chronic muscle tension, break up scar tissue, and improve range of motion. For those deep muscle tensions, this technique is important.
    • Myofascial Release: This technique focuses on releasing tension in the fascia, the connective tissue that surrounds and supports your muscles. By applying gentle, sustained pressure, the therapist can help release restrictions and improve movement. Release is the key component here.
    • Trigger Point Therapy: This technique targets trigger points, which are localized areas of muscle that are tender and can cause referred pain. The therapist applies direct pressure to these trigger points to help release the tension and alleviate pain. To avoid pain, this therapy is important.
    • Sports Massage: This is a more general term that encompasses a variety of techniques designed to prepare the body for activity, promote recovery, and address specific injuries. It often involves a combination of techniques, such as effleurage (long, gliding strokes), petrissage (kneading), and tapotement (rhythmic tapping). Sports massage helps sports enthusiasts.
    • Stretching: Therapists often incorporate stretching exercises to improve flexibility and range of motion. This can include both passive stretching (where the therapist moves your body) and active stretching (where you actively engage your muscles). Stretching can make your body more active.
